Basic working principle and characteristics of Hammer Mills

Hammer Mills is a mechanical equipment that uses a high-speed rotating hammer for crushing. It crushes the raw materials into the required particle size through the collision, tearing and shearing of the hammer and the material. Hammer mills have the advantages of simple structure, convenient operation and easy maintenance. They are widely used in the crushing of various materials such as feed, grain, fertilizer, minerals, etc.

In the grain, oil and feed machinery industry, Hammer Mills can process grain raw materials, feed raw materials and other materials into powders of different particle sizes through screens of different models and sizes to meet the requirements of different customers for particle size. This efficient crushing process not only improves the utilization rate of raw materials, but also provides the necessary material basis for subsequent feed formulation, mixing and pressing.

Key advantages for improving production capacity.

1. Efficient material crushing performance

One of the core advantages of Hammer Mills is its excellent crushing efficiency. Traditional feed processing equipment often takes a long time to complete the crushing when processing large quantities of materials. Hammer Mills can greatly shorten the processing time and improve production efficiency with its high-speed rotating hammer head and unique crushing method. Especially in large-scale grain and oil feed production, Hammer Mills can achieve continuous operation, ensure the efficient operation of the production line, and maximize production capacity.

2. Adapt to the processing needs of different materials

In the grain and oil feed machinery industry, there are many kinds of raw materials that need to be crushed, including corn, soybeans, wheat bran and other grains and plant materials. Hammer Mills can adapt to the crushing needs of different materials by adjusting the aperture size of the screen and the working mode of the hammer head. Whether it is hard particles or soft and fragile materials, Hammer Mills can process them efficiently and stably to meet diverse production needs. This versatility makes Hammer Mills a tool for increasing production capacity in the grain and oil feed industry.

3. Optimize raw material utilization

In the grain and oil feed production process, efficient use of raw materials is the key to increasing production capacity. Hammer Mills can crush raw materials into fine particles, thereby improving the utilization rate of raw materials in subsequent production links. Fine crushing can make the raw materials more uniform in the subsequent mixing, molding and other processes, ensuring that the nutrients of the feed are fully utilized and reducing waste. This efficient material utilization not only improves production efficiency, but also reduces production costs for enterprises and enhances market competitiveness.

Promote the improvement of automation level

1. Integration of automatic control systems

Modern Hammer Mills are usually equipped with intelligent control systems that can automatically adjust the crushing speed, screen aperture and hammer working mode according to production needs. These intelligent control systems can monitor the operating status of the equipment in real time, automatically adjust the operating parameters, and ensure that the equipment is always operating in the optimal working state. Automated control not only reduces the need for manual operation and improves production efficiency, but also greatly reduces equipment failures and production losses caused by operational errors.

2. Automated material transportation and distribution

In traditional feed processing production lines, the transportation and distribution of materials often rely on manual or semi-automated equipment. Modern Hammer Mills have been closely integrated with automated material conveying systems to achieve full automation of material flow. Through conveyor belts, screw conveyors and other equipment, raw materials can be quickly and efficiently transported to Hammer Mills for crushing, and the crushed materials can also automatically flow into the next processing link. This automated system not only improves production speed, but also reduces manual intervention and reduces labor costs.

3. Accurate production data monitoring

With the support of intelligent systems, modern Hammer Mills can collect and analyze production data in real time, including material crushing time, particle size distribution, power consumption, etc. These data can help production managers accurately evaluate the operating status of equipment, identify potential problems and make timely adjustments. Through data management, every link in the production process can be monitored and optimized, thereby further improving the automation level and production efficiency of the production line.
